Brooklyn College Chiller Plant
Brooklyn, NY

ASHRAE Regional
Technology Award - Region 1 1st Place-Existing Industrial
Buildings
LORING
served as prime consultant for the study and design of a 10,000-ton
hybrid chiller plant and two miles of chilled water distribution
system piping on the campus of
Brooklyn
College. Services included cycle design, proposal support, design project
management and complete mechanical, electrical, plumbing,
architectural and structural design. The project was performed on a
design/build basis.
The challenge was to develop a chilled water plant and chilled water
distribution system that had the right balance between initial
capital cost and recurring operations and maintenance costs, thus
providing
Brooklyn
College
with the best value: a project with the most favorable life cycle
cost.
The project also needed to provide flexibility in order to
optimize operations in the new, deregulated electric utility market.
